this is an ignorant question but i want to learn the answer.
what is the point of record labels in 2023? why does one need to sign with them?
it used to be you would sign with them for studio time and to get your album printed and sent all over the country/world to record stores. and probably get your s*** played on the radio too.
now with streaming and youtube..... i mean whats the reason to sign? rent your own studio space (yes this takes money but i think technology makes the recording process less dependent on big fancy studios) and put your s*** out.
i think it makes sense to sign with a touring company because organizing a tour would be hard (booking venues, liability etc) but the music part seems like indy is the way to go now
